""Chapters and Speeches on the Irish Land Question"" is a book written by John Stuart Mill in 1870. The book is a collection of Mill's speeches on the issue of Irish land reform, which he gave in the British Parliament during the mid-19th century. The book is divided into several chapters, each of which focuses on a different aspect of the Irish land question. Mill argues that the Irish people are suffering from a lack of ownership and control over their own land, which has led to poverty and social unrest. He advocates for land reform that would give Irish tenants greater security and control over their land, as well as fair compensation for improvements made to the land. Mill's speeches are notable for their clear and persuasive arguments, as well as their passionate defense of the rights of the Irish people. John Stuart Mill was an English philosopher, politician and economist most famous for his contributions to the theory of utilitarianism. The author of numerous influential political treatises, Mill s writings on liberty, freedom of speech, democracy and economics have helped to form the foundation of modern liberal thought. His 1859 work, On Liberty, is particularly noteworthy for helping to address the nature and limits of the power of the state over the individual. Mills has become one of the most influential figures in nineteenth-century philosophy, and his writings are still widely studied and analyzed by scholars. Mills died in 1873 at the age of 66.
